Zwangsbedingungen können auf ein Gruppe von Definitionspunkten definiert werden, Definitionspunkte sind:
Definitionspunkte bei der Erzeugung eines Solids aus 2D-Profilen
Falls mit Zwangsbedingungen und Parametern in Profil-basierten Solids gearbeitet werden soll, muss ein Solid zuerst zum Bearbeiten angewählt werden. Danach wird das entsprechende Symbol in der Bearbeitungs-Werkzeugleiste angeklickt und der Bearbeitungs-Modus wird in den Modus für "Solidprofil Bindungen" umgeschaltet. Nach einer erfolgten Anbringung von Zwangsbedingungen wird beim nachträglichen Ändern immer in den Modus für "Solidprofil Bindungen" umgeschaltet, man kann in den Modus zum Bearbeiten der 2D-Profile durch Anwahl des Icons "Profil bearbeiten" in der Werkzeugleiste zurückschalten.
Vom 2D-Profil Bearbeitungs-Modus in den Modus für "Solidprofil Bindungen" umschalten
Definitionspunkte können in einem definierten Abstand zum Koordinatenursprung oder an einen anderen Definitionspunkt (einem Ankerpunkt) gebunden werden. Der Abstand kann als konstanter Wert, über einen Parameter oder einen mathematischen Ausdruck, der Parameter enthält, angegeben werden. Wenn die entsprechenden Parameter geändert werden, ändert sich die Position der Definitionspunkte.
Definitionspunkte können in Richtung der X-Achse, Y-Achse oder in radialer Richtung gebunden werden. Die Zwangsbedingungen können für X- und Y-Achse unabhängig definiert werden. Jedoch, falls Definitionspunkte in radialer Richtung gebunden sind, können sie nicht zugleich in X- und Y-Richtung gebunden werden und umgekehrt. Beim Versuch der Festlegung einer solchen Zwangsbedingung, werden Sie informiert, dass bestehende Bindungen überschrieben werden.
Eine Zwangsbedingung wird für eine Gruppe von einem oder mehreren Definitionspunkten festgelegt. Nach Wahl der Definitionspunkte muss ein Referenzpunkt aus den bereits gewählten Punkten festgelegt werden. Der gebundene Abstand ist der Abstand vom Koordinatenursprung oder Ankerpunkt zum Referenzpunkt. Wird der Abstandswert geändert, werden alle Definitionspunkte entsprechend verschoben.
Symbol | Methode |
Bindung eines Objektes in X-Richtung zum Koordinatenursprung | |
Bindung eines Objektes in X-Richtung an ein weiteres Objekt | |
Bindung eines Objektes in Y-Richtung zum Koordinatenursprung | |
Bindung eines Objektes in Y-Richtung an ein weiteres Objekt | |
Bindung eines Objektes in einem bestimmten Winkel und Abstand zum Koordinatenursprung | |
Bindung eines Objektes in einem bestimmten Winkel und Abstand an ein weiteres Objekt | |
Änderung einer Kreisbogendefinition: von 2 Punkte, Radius zu 2 Punkte, Radius und Zentrum und umgekehrt | |
Änderung eines Fasenabstandes | |
Änderung des Radius eines Kreises, Kreisbogens oder einer Verrundung | |
Anzeigen der Zwangsbedingungen und Koordinatensysteme | |
Überprüfen von Profilabmessungen | |
Ändern einer bestehenden Zwangsbedingung | |
Löschen einer bestehenden Zwangsbedingung | |
Ändern eines bestehenden Koordinatensystems | |
Umdefinieren des Koordinatensystems einer Zwangsbedingung. Die X/Y Koordinaten werden auf den neuen Winkel bezogen | |
Profilbearbeitung beenden | |
Geometrie-Erzeugung ändern ohne Profiländerung | |
Ohne Änderung zurück nach 3D |
Definitionspunkte können einzeln, Punkt für Punkt oder folgendermaßen gewählt werden:
Wahl von Definitionspunkten innerhalb eines Auswahlfensters |
Wahl von Definitionspunkten außerhalb eines Auswahlfensters |
Umschalten zwischen hinzufügen zur Elementwahl oder entfernen aus der Auswahl |
Falls Definitionspunkte nicht wählbar sind, werden sie in einer anderen Farbe dargestellt. Die Anwahl von Definitionspunkten wird unterbunden wenn:
Es ist auch möglich, direkt nach der Anwahl der Definitionspunkte über das Kontextmenü die gewünschten Schritte zur Bindungsdefinition auszuwählen.
Ähnlich wie beim Erzeugen und Ändern von 2D-Profilen kann auch hier die grafische Darstellung umgeschaltet werden:
Umschalten zwischen dicken und dünnen Umrisslinien im 2D |
Umschalten zwischen voll schattierter und Drahtgitterdarstellung |
Radien von Kreisen und Bögen, sowie Verrundungen können als parametrische Werte definiert werden, ebenso wie Werte für die Fasen. Die Definition einer Zwangsbedingung ist für die Änderung eines Radius oder einer Fase nicht zwingend notwendig. Wählen Sie einfach das Objekt und definieren Sie eine neuen Wert.
Verrundete und abgefaste Ecken werden als Rundung oder Fase erkannt, wenn die Kantenbearbeitung im 2D-Modus im Raum erfolgt ist. Bei Profilen, die im 2D-Zeichnungsmodus erstellt wurden, wird eine Rundung nur erkannt, wenn diese zwischen 2 linearen Segmenten erstellt wurde. Im Fall einer verrundeten oder abgefasten Ecke ist der Definitionspunkt der Endpunkt der ursprünglichen Ecke. Die Verbindungspunkte der Rundungen und Fasen werden anders als die ursprünglichen Linien- oder Bogensegment-Endpunkte dargestellt. Diese Verbindungspunkte können nicht für die Definition von Zwangsbedingungen gewählt werden, sie können jedoch für Messungen herangezogen werden.
Standardmäßig sind Kreisbögen über 2 Endpunkte und einen Radius definiert. Falls notwendig, kann der Mittelpunkt zur Definition hinzugefügt werden. In diesem Fall müssen die Endpunkte explizit neu berechnet werden, anderenfalls kann es passieren, dass sie nicht den exakten Abstand vom Kreiszentrum aufweisen.
Eine Ausnahme bilden Endpunkte von Kreisbögen wenn sie nur in X- oder Y-Richtung gebunden sind. Zum Beispiel: Wenn der Endpunkt in X-Richtung gebunden ist, ist die X-Koordinate genau definiert, dies gilt ebenfalls für das Kreiszentrum. Die Y-Koordinate wird nach jeder Änderung der X-Koordinate oder des Radius des Kreisbogens neu errechnet. Je nach Lage der geometrischen Elemente kann es passieren dass es keine mathematische Lösung gibt, wenn jedoch eine Lösung existiert ist damit die neue Position des Kreisbogen-Endpunktes exakt festgelegt.
NURBS sind interpolierte Kurven die über einen Punktesatz definiert sind. Die Kontur der Kurve kann verändert werden, indem man die Positionen von Interpolationspunkten ändert. Die Interpolationspunkte können, wie andere Definitionspunkte auch, an Zwangsbedingungen gebunden werden - entweder als einzelne Punkte oder als Punktesatz in einer gebundenen Gruppe.
Zum Bearbeiten von Bindungen muss zuerst ein einzelner Definitionspunkt gewählt werden. Ist dieser Punkt Mitglied von zwei Bindungsgruppen (zum Beispiel eine Gruppe ist in X-Richtung gebunden, eine weitere in Y-Richtung), muss zuerst die gewünschte Bindungsart gewählt werden. Definitionspunkte werden zur Gruppe hinzugefügt oder daraus entfernt. Nach Bestätigung der Auswahl wird der Abstand der Gruppe bestätigt oder neu definiert. Referenz- oder Ankerpunkte können nicht geändert werden, wenn sie bereits an einen anderen Definitionspunkt gebunden sind.
Zuerst wird ein Definitionspunkt einer Bindungsgruppe ausgewählt. Nach Bestätigung des Löschvorganges werden alle Zwangsbedingungen dieser Bindungsgruppe entfernt.
Im Normalfall wird im Weltkoordinatensystem von VariCAD gearbeitet. Die X-Achse ist nach rechts, die Y-Koordinate nach oben gerichtet, der Ursprung des Koordinatensystems wird bei der Profilerzeugung festgelegt. Falls notwendig kann das Koordinatensystem für eine Gruppe von gewählten Definitionspunkten neu definiert werden. Das neue Koordinatensystem kann über folgende Methoden festgelegt werden:
Ursprung am gewählten Definitionspunkt, X-Richtung zu einem gewählten Definitionspunkt |
Ursprung am gewählten Definitionspunkt, X-Richtung unter bestimmtem Winkel |
Ursprung über X/Y festgelegt, X-Richtung zu einem gewählten Definitionspunkt |
Ursprung über X/Y festgelegt, X-Richtung unter bestimmtem Winkel |
Koordinatenursprung auf das Bezugs-System zurücksetzen |
Falls der Koordinatenursprung über X/Y Koordinaten oder über eine Winkel zur X-Achse definiert ist, können auch Parameter anstatt konstanter Werte verwendet werden. Bei Änderung des Koordinatenursprungs oder des X-Achsen Winkels werden die Positionen aller Definitionspunkte ebenfalls neu errechnet.
Wenn das Koordinatensystem für einen Satz von Definitionspunkten umdefiniert wird, können Zwangsbedingungen nur für Definitionspunkte mit demselben Koordinatensystem festgelegt werden.